About This Spot

Stepping into La Tasca 7, you immediately sense a laid-back hideaway along Arona’s scenic Paseo Marítimo. It’s the kind of spot where the rhythm slows down gently, inviting you to settle into a moment framed by the soothing sea breeze and warm island light. The wide terrace, with its unhurried views of the promenade and the waves beyond, encourages long conversations over thoughtfully prepared meals and refreshing drinks.

Here, the atmosphere leans comfortably toward casual local dining with a Mediterranean soul, blending familiar flavors with a touch of home-style warmth. The friendly service fosters a feeling of being welcomed into a shared table among neighbors, where both regulars and visitors find common ground. It’s not uncommon to hear laughter or catch quiet exchanges that feel as intuitively personal as the tapas and specialties being served.

At La Tasca 7, the menu carries the essence of the region’s coastal bounty and rustic charm, presented in generous portions that invite you to savor at your own pace. Whether you’re drawn to dishes showcasing the simple delight of grilled prawns with garlic or tempted by a hearty serving of homemade meatballs paired with classic potatoes bravas, the experience goes beyond just eating. It’s about savoring the textures and aromas that evoke memories of shared meals and leisurely afternoons. The locally inspired sangria and approachable wine list complement the food with just the right balance of refreshment.

As the sun dips toward the horizon, the ambience shifts softly, and the terrace becomes a vantage point for moments of quiet contemplation or relaxed connection. It’s this blend of easy charm and genuine warmth that places La Tasca 7 firmly in the heart of the community, a place where time feels a little more generous and every visit offers a chance to discover something quietly special.

Guest Reviews

Ying Qiu 06 Jan 2026

This place is amazing, we stayed in this area for 4 days, this is our best choice. Also they could make food that we asked not on menu. The price is very reasonable.

The House 17 Nov 2025

Fab peaceful place for a nice and cheap Large cocktail - 5 euros for an alcoholic one and 4 for alcohol free. Beer was 2 euros. Food looks good Nice service On the sea

Tenerife Julie 16 Nov 2025

Great location to watch the sun set! Really friendly service. Very reasonably priced. Large outside terrace. Generous portions. I enjoyed chicken fillet with Mushroom Sauce, papas arrugadas and vegetables. Served hot.

SeanP 14 Nov 2025

Lovely bar and restaurant with sea views along the promenade, 200 metres from Los Christianos Market. Reasonably priced. We were unfortunate to witness the grumpy manager arguing loudly with staff. Not good for business. Staff were helpful and efficient

Jac x 22 Oct 2025

Came across this restaurant whilst walking past our hotel which was very close. Stopped for drinks. Went back next day for a meal. Sat in comfy seats overlooking the promenade & views of the sea, whilst having drinks. Staff friendly, seemed to have regulars who were chatting to staff - Good sign Food was good we went for the Tapas

Nivek Nilknarf 10 Oct 2025

Cheapest cocktails at 5 euros each and the food was excellent. Staff were very friendly and attentive.
